Morgan Hunt UK Ltd is seeking an Electrical Installation Lecturer to join a leading Further Education provider in Ipswich. The role involves delivering engaging lessons across Level 1-3 Electrical Installation programmes, combining practical and theoretical sessions.
The successful candidate will have a Level 3 qualification, relevant industry experience, and a passion for education. Competitive annual salary of up to £47,000 or temporary rate of £45 per hour is available along with generous benefits.
